Damping parametric instabilities in future gravitational wave detectors by means of electrostatic actuators

Kavli Affiliate: Richard Mittleman | Summary:It has been suggested that the next generation of interferometric gravitational wave detectors may observe spontaneously excited parametric oscillatory instabilities. We present a method of actively suppressing any such instability through application of electrostatic forces to the interferometers’ test masses. Core or cusps: The central dark matter profile of a redshift one strong lensing cluster with a bright central image

Kavli Affiliate: Rafe Schindler | Summary:We report on SPT-CLJ2011-5228, a giant system of arcs created by a cluster at $z=1.06$. The arc system is notable for the presence of a bright central image. First Data Release of the Hyper Suprime-Cam Subaru Strategic Program

Kavli Affiliate: Hiroaki Aihara | Summary:The Hyper Suprime-Cam Subaru Strategic Program (HSC-SSP) is a three-layered imaging survey aimed at addressing some of the most outstanding questions in astronomy today, including the nature of dark matter and dark energy. Two- and Three-Dimensional Probes of Parity in Primordial Gravity Waves

Kavli Affiliate: Kiyoshi Wesley Masui | Summary:We show that three-dimensional information is critical to discerning the effects of parity violation in the primordial gravity-wave background. If present, helical gravity waves induce parity-violating correlations in the cosmic microwave background (CMB) between parity-odd polarization $B$-modes and parity-even temperature anisotropies ($T$) or polarization $E$-modes.
